Panchala Kingdom

900 BC – 350 BC
KingdomAsia

One of the most powerful Vedic states of north India, allied with the Kuru kingdom, later recognized as one of the sixteen Mahajanapadas after transformation into an oligarchic confederacy.

The Panchala kingdom was absorbed by the Nanda Empire under Mahapadma Nanda c. 345–321 BCE, regained independence after the Nanda collapse, and was finally and permanently conquered by the Gupta Empire under Samudragupta c. 350 CE, ending its existence as an independent polity.
